What does a power electronics machine learning engineer do?

A Power Electronics Machine Learning Engineer combines expertise in electrical engineering, specifically power electronics, with machine learning techniques to develop smarter, more efficient electronic systems. They work on optimizing the performance of devices such as inverters, converters, and motor drives by applying data-driven algorithms. Their role may involve tasks like predictive maintenance, system modeling, anomaly detection, and control optimization, often using real-time sensor data. This intersection of disciplines is increasingly important for modern applications in renewable energy, electric vehicles, and industrial automation.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a power electronics machine learning engineer,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Power Electronics Machine Learning Engineer, you need a solid grounding in electrical engineering, power electronics, and machine learning, typically backed by a relevant degree and experience in both hardware and software domains. Familiarity with simulation tools (such as MATLAB/Simulink), programming languages (like Python), and machine learning frameworks (such as TensorFlow or PyTorch) is commonly required. Strong problem-solving skills, effective communication, and the ability to collaborate across multidisciplinary teams set outstanding candidates apart. These skills and qualifications are crucial for designing innovative solutions that leverage AI to optimize power electronic systems and drive technological advancements.

How does a power electronics machine learning engineer typically collaborate with cross-functional teams during project development?

Power Electronics Machine Learning Engineers often work closely with hardware engineers, embedded software developers, and data scientists to integrate machine learning algorithms into power electronic systems. Collaboration involves regular meetings to align on system requirements, data collection strategies, and model deployment. These engineers also coordinate with testing and validation teams to ensure models perform reliably under real-world operating conditions, fostering a multidisciplinary environment that enhances innovation and problem-solving.
